STI Prevention & Regular Testing
Regular STI testing is the single most important sexual health practice for anyone sexually active — and especially for escort professionals who work with multiple clients. Testing for common STIs including HIV, chlamydia, gonorrhoea, syphilis and hepatitis should be conducted at minimum every three months for sexually active escorts — and more frequently for those with higher numbers of partners. Many sexual health clinics offer free and confidential testing services — and at-home testing kits are widely available for those who prefer to test privately. Knowing your status is not just a personal health responsibility — it is a professional obligation that reflects genuine care for the wellbeing of everyone you work with.
Safe Sex Practices for Escorts & Clients
Consistent and correct condom use remains the most effective available protection against the transmission of most STIs during sexual contact — and should be treated as a non-negotiable professional standard by all escort professionals. PrEP — Pre-Exposure Prophylaxis — is a highly effective daily medication that dramatically reduces the risk of HIV transmission and is increasingly widely available through sexual health clinics and GP services in most countries. Dental dams provide protection during oral-vaginal and oral-anal contact. Regular vaccination against HPV and hepatitis B provides long-term protection against two of the most common sexually transmitted infections affecting the escort community.
Sexual Health & Mental Wellbeing
Physical sexual health and mental wellbeing are deeply interconnected — and both deserve equal attention and care. Anxiety, depression and unresolved trauma can all manifest as sexual health challenges — affecting libido, sexual function and the ability to experience genuine intimacy and pleasure. For escort professionals, maintaining clear emotional boundaries between professional and personal sexual life is an essential component of long-term mental and sexual health — one that requires conscious attention, regular self-reflection and access to appropriate professional support when needed.
Sexual Health Resources & Support
Access to accurate, non-judgmental sexual health information and support is a fundamental right for everyone — regardless of their profession, relationship structure or sexual practices. In the US, Planned Parenthood provides comprehensive sexual health services including testing, treatment and education. In the UK, NHS sexual health clinics offer free and confidential services nationwide. The BASHH — British Association for Sexual Health and HIV — provides detailed clinical guidelines and patient resources. Sex worker-specific sexual health organizations including SWOP USA provide targeted support for escort professionals.
